New coverage region: Finger Lakes NY wedding photographer
Wednesday, March 24, 2010 at 05:00PM 
I'm so very excited to announce that starting this year (2010), we are now expanding our local coverage region into the Finger Lakes NY area -- including Ithaca, Syracuse, Rochester, Watkins Glen, and all of the amazing locations in between and around these cities. These locations have been added to our growing list of local regions, so as with our current local regions, there will be no travel fees for coverage in these areas.
We'll continue to shoot all of our other local regions while we add on this new presence in the finger lakes, so Philadelphia, New York, Boston, New Jersey, and Delaware area weddings and engagements are welcome as always. And, of course, we'll also continue traveling for our destination wedding bookings around the US and internationally as well.
Our family spends a lot of time out on the finger lakes in the summer, and it only makes sense that I should be shooting there! The area is chock full of beautiful old estates, amazing lakeside properties, outstanding colleges, and gorgeous state parks, and it's the perfect location for a wedding. I've gotten really familiar with this part of New York over the past several years and can't wait to start exploring all of the unique wedding spots on the vineyards, around the lakes, and in all of the great little towns and cities nearby.
